To understand the contribution of the statistician in Myanmar Yangon, it is first necessary to define their core competencies. A modern statisticist employs a combination of descriptive and inferential statistics to summarize data sets and draw conclusions about populations based on samples. In Myanmar Yangon , these skills are applied through several key methodologies:
- Data Collection Design: In a region where comprehensive census data may be outdated or fragmented, statisticians must design efficient sampling strategies to gather accurate information. This is crucial in Myanmar Yangon for assessing consumer behavior , economic indicators , and public health trends.
- Predictive Modeling: Using historical data from sectors such as real estate and logistics in Myanmar Yangon , statisticians develop models that predict future market movements. These models help businesses mitigate risk and optimize resource allocation.
- A/B Testing and Quality Control: In the manufacturing sector, which is a significant driver of the economy in Myanmar Yangon , statisticians implement control charts and experimental designs to maintain product quality and operational efficiency.
3.1 Economic Development and Financial Services
The financial sector in Myanmar Yangon is expanding rapidly, with the emergence of fintech companies and traditional banks alike. Statisticians are indispensable in this domain for credit scoring risk assessment , and fraud detection. By analyzing transactional data from millions of users, statisticians can identify patterns indicative of default or malicious activity. For instance , machine learning algorithms powered by statistical principles allow financial institutions in Myanmar Yangon to offer micro-loans to underserved populations, thereby promoting financial inclusion while managing systemic risk.
3.2 Public Health and Epidemiology
The role of the statistician is perhaps most visible in public health initiatives. In Myanmar Yangon , where urban density poses challenges for disease control , statistical modeling is used to track the spread of infectious diseases such as dengue fever and respiratory illnesses. During recent global health crises, statisticians provided critical insights into transmission rates vaccination coverage and healthcare capacity utilization . Their work directly informed government policies regarding lockdowns resource distribution and public communication strategies in Myanmar Yangon.
3.3 Agriculture and Supply Chain
Agriculture remains a vital part of Myanmar’s economy , with many supply chains originating from rural areas but converging in the markets of Myanmar Yangon . Statisticians help optimize these supply chains by analyzing weather patterns crop yields and market prices. By providing farmers and distributors with data-driven insights on optimal planting times and distribution routes, statisticians contribute to reducing waste improving food security and increasing profitability for stakeholders involved in the agricultural sector.
Despite the growing demand for statistical expertise , there are significant challenges that professionals in this field must navigate. One major issue is data quality and availability. In many parts of Myanmar Yangon , data may be siloed inconsistent or lacking standardization, which complicates analysis efforts. Furthermore, there is a skills gap; while international standards for statistical education exist local implementation varies widely.
Another challenge is the cultural resistance to data-driven decision making. In traditional business environments in Myanmar Yangon , decisions are often based on intuition or hierarchical authority rather than empirical evidence. Overcoming this requires statisticians not only to be technically proficient but also to possess strong communication skills that can translate complex statistical concepts into practical business language.
